是的,PHP 支持排序和评分机制。您可以使用 PHP 内置的排序函数对数组进行排序,同时也可以实现评分机制。以下是一些示例代码:
- 对数组进行排序:
- 实现评分机制:
"Book A", "rating" => 4.5), array("title" => "Book B", "rating" => 3.8), array("title" => "Book C", "rating" => 4.7), array("title" => "Book D", "rating" => 3.9) ); // 使用 usort() 函数根据评分对书籍进行排序 usort($books, function($a, $b) { return $b["rating"] <=> $a["rating"]; }); // 输出排序后的书籍信息 foreach ($books as $book) { echo "Title: " . $book["title"] . ", Rating: " . $book["rating"] . "
"; } ?>
在这个示例中,我们使用了 usort()
函数和一个自定义的比较函数来根据评分对书籍数组进行降序排序。您可以根据自己的需求修改这些示例代码以满足您的排序和评分需求。